About

In recent decades, authors affiliated with Plastic Surgery Hospital have published 1.1k papers, which have received a total of 20.1k indexed citations. Scholars at this organization have produced 599 papers in Surgery, 204 papers in Dermatology and 125 papers in Molecular Biology on the topics of Reconstructive Surgery and Microvascular Techniques (231 papers), Reconstructive Facial Surgery Techniques (161 papers) and Facial Rejuvenation and Surgery Techniques (110 papers). Their work is cited by papers focused on Surgery (11.4k citations), Molecular Biology (2.2k citations) and Epidemiology (2.1k citations). Authors at Plastic Surgery Hospital collaborate with scholars in China, United States and Canada and have published in prestigious journals including Journal of Clinical Investigation, Journal of Clinical Oncology and Nano Letters. Some of Plastic Surgery Hospital's most productive authors include Yeguang Song, Yeliang Song, Gregory A. Dumanian, Ruyao Song, Guangdong Zhou, Neil A. Fine, R Song, Yuguang Gao, Yingna Song and John Y. S. Kim.
